6.0 VMX Power Supply Maintenance

Maintenance must be performed every three to six months. By establishing a routine maintenance
program, and following the guidelines contained in this manual, the VMX Power Supply will provide
years of trouble-free operation.

Care of the batteries is the fi rst step in any power supply maintenance program. In addition to
voltage checks, visually inspect the batteries for signs of cracking, leaking, or swelling. To aid in
quick identifi cation and tracking of voltages in the maintenance log, number the batteries inside the
enclosure using labels or masking tape, etc. Batteries are temperature sensitive and susceptible to
overcharging and undercharging. Since batteries behave differently in the winter than in the summer,
Alpha’s battery chargers automatically compensate for changes in temperature by adjusting fl oat and
accept charge voltages.

6.1 Check Battery Open Circuit Voltage

Prior to testing, record the battery manufacturer, date code, lot number, and power supply’s
model number and serial Number.

Inspect all battery posts, verify that all connections are clean and tight. Reapply corrosion
inhibitor.

Disconnect the AlphaGuard CMT (if used) and switch the front panel battery breaker of the
VMX Power Supply Inverter to OFF. Disconnect the battery connector from the inverter and
measure the individual voltage across each battery. The difference between any battery in the
string should not be greater than 0.3Vdc. Defective or marginal batteries should be replaced
with an identical type of battery. Record the unloaded battery voltages in the maintenance
log.

CAUTION!

The VMX Power Supply must be serviced by qualifi ed personnel.

Alpha Technologies is not responsible for battery damage due to improper charger voltage settings.
Consult the battery manufacturer for correct charger voltage requirements.

When removing batteries, ALWAYS switch the battery breaker off before unplugging the battery connector.

Always wear safety glasses when working with batteries.
